Parish Life at St Clare's

Extraordinary Ministers of the Eucharist serve in a special way in assisting the Pastor. They are asked to help administer communion during Mass as well as bringing communion to the sick and homebound. Father selects an appropriate number of people to accommodate all the Masses and each will serve for a two year period.
